Cincinatti select...

DT Dre (Marchondray) Moore, Maryland

No stand out options here, basically came down to a DT or TE, unfortunately the 9 previous picks have seen the top 2 ranked TE and the 3rd-5th ranked DTs go off the board, so this pick may be seen as a bit of a reach, but Moore has terrific upside.

The Bengals need a DT, Peko is decent enough, but Thornton isnt great and there isnt much depth. Moore could play in either the 3-4 or 4-3 so should be able to do the job in a four man front for the Bungles.

He's certainly big enough at 6-4, is very athletic and quick (quickest DT in the draft), has potential to wreak havoc in the backfield, however he is pretty raw and could simply be a workout warrior. Boom or bust i suppose.

Went him over Marcus Harrison simply because Harrison has off field character issues which is something the Bungles certainly do not need. Red Bryant was also considered.

With pick # 48 the Vikings take Carl Nicks OT Nebraska.

The Vikings have had a dominant running game over the last few years, mostly on the back of C Matt Birk, LG Steve Hutchinson and LT Bryant McKinnie. On the right side RG Anthony Herrera stepped up last year and has been given a 5 year contract extension. This leaves RT Ryan Cook as the only question mark in an otherwise dominating front line.

Its also possible that Bryant McKinnie may face some time off at the start of the season due to an off-season incident outside a night club in Miami.

Carl Nicks was nearly my BPA on my draft sheet, so Nicks it is. Nicks played RT as a junior and LT as a senior, and I can see him competing for Cook's starting position, or backing up McKinnie early in the season.

I also considered Safety, Tight End and Quarterback, but no-one jumped out as offering more than Nicks.
